The Technical Security Technician I (Systems) is responsible for system administration, reporting, maintenance, and repair support of closed-circuit camera and digital recording systems, electronic access control systems, security and fire alarm systems, and similar devices. The employee is responsible for setup, diagnosing system problems, making minor repairs, and instructing others in the use and operation of the electronic surveillance systems and companion digital recording systems, fire and security alarm systems, and electronic access control systems. The work is performed according to manufacturers’ technical information and standard service practices of the security surveillance and access control trade and state law.
